I love to use distinctive pens for different things. I use thick markers for big shadows as they’re significant and chunky and cover a lot of paper immediately. I like Sharpies for smaller shadows and thick constant traces.

Black carbon inks are sold both as blocks being ground, pastes to generally be diluted or bottled liquids to be used neat. They encompass a range of Chinese and Japanese inks, together with Indian Ink – originally a Chinese ink manufactured with products from India.
